Module: AWS::Core::OptionGrammar::Descriptors::Integer

Extended by:
NoArgs
Defined in:
lib/aws/core/option_grammar.rb

Instance Method Summary collapse

Methods included from NoArgs

apply

Instance Method Details

#encode_value(value) ⇒ Object


130
131
132
# File 'lib/aws/core/option_grammar.rb', line 130

def encode_value(value)
  value.to_s
end

#validate(value, context = nil) ⇒ Object


125
126
127
128
# File 'lib/aws/core/option_grammar.rb', line 125

def validate(value, context = nil)
  raise format_error("integer value", context) unless
    value.respond_to? :to_int
end